1 Kings 18:34 — Bible Verse (KJV)
“And he said, Do it the second time. And they did it the second time. And he said, Do it the third time. And they did it the third time.”

1 Kings 18:34 GEN — Geneva Bible (1599)
“And said, Fill foure barrels with water, and powre it on the burnt offring and on the wood. Againe he said, Doe so againe. And they did so the second time. And he sayde, Doe it the third time. And they did it the third time.”
